No clue. I'd put a "bash" instruction in send_uc_ipv4(), which would act
as a sort of break point for the script (opens an interactive sub-shell),
then run it again with bash -x, manually repeat the command that failed,
investigate why it failed and hit Ctrl-d when I'm done.
